mesa

Mesa is a language of between PASCAL and ADA in philosophy and
sophistication, though much closer to ADA.  Its main distinguishing
characteristics are incredibly strong typing, complete cross-module
type consistancy checking, excellent facilities for modularization
and information-hiding within modules.  The MESA environment
features the most extensive configuration control and debugging
facilities I have ever seen.

I recommend "Mesa, Language Manual" and "Early Experience with MESA",
both Xerox publications available from PARC.
